Trust Wallet(トラストウォレット)に二重請求が起きた時の対処法
近年、デジタル資産の取引が急速に普及する中で、ユーザーが自らの仮想通貨やトークンを安全に管理するために、さまざまなウォレットアプリが利用されています。その中でも特に人気の高いのが「Trust Wallet(トラストウォレット)」です。このアプリは、イーサリアム基盤上の多くのトークンに対応しており、ユーザーインターフェースの直感性と高いセキュリティが評価されています。しかし、こうした便利なサービスにもリスクは伴います。なかでも「二重請求(ダブルチャージ)」という問題は、一部のユーザーにとって深刻なトラブルとなることがあります。本稿では、Trust Walletに二重請求が発生した場合の原因、具体的な対処法、そして今後の予防策について、専門的な観点から詳しく解説します。
1. 二重請求とは何か?
二重請求とは、同一の取引に対して複数回の支払いが行われる状態を指します。たとえば、1つの決済が正常に行われた後に、システムエラーまたは悪意ある操作により同じ金額の支払いが再度実行されてしまうケースです。これは、従来の銀行決済やクレジットカード決済でも発生することがありますが、仮想通貨ウォレット環境では、トランザクションの不可逆性(一度送金すると取り消せない)が加わることで、被害が拡大しやすくなります。
Trust Walletは、ユーザーが所有する暗号資産を自身のデバイス上に保管する「ホワイトハット・ウォレット(非中央集権型ウォレット)」であり、ウォレット自体が取引を直接処理するわけではありません。代わりに、ブロックチェーンネットワーク上でトランザクションを送信する機能を提供しています。このため、二重請求の原因は、ユーザーの誤操作、ネットワーク遅延、あるいは外部の悪意あるアプリとの連携ミスなど、多岐にわたります。
2. Trust Walletにおける二重請求の主な原因
2.1 ネットワーク遅延によるトランザクションの再送信
仮想通貨取引は、ブロックチェーン上の承認プロセスを経て完了します。しかし、ネットワークの混雑やガス代(手数料)の設定が低すぎる場合、トランザクションが長時間処理されずに保留されることがあります。この状況下で、ユーザーが「送金が失敗した」と誤解し、同じトランザクションを再送信してしまうケースがあります。結果として、2つのトランザクションがブロックチェーンに登録され、両方とも有効となり、実質的に二重請求が発生します。
2.2 ウォレットアプリ内のバグや不具合
Trust Wallet自体のソフトウェアにバグがある場合、取引履歴の表示やトランザクションの送信処理に不具合が生じることがあります。たとえば、一度送信されたトランザクションが「未完了」として表示され続け、ユーザーが再送信を試みるといった現象が起こります。このような場合、ユーザーの意思とは関係なく複数の送金が実行され、二重請求のリスクが高まります。
2.3 外部アプリとの連携ミス
Trust Walletは、多くのDeFi(分散型金融)プラットフォームや、NFTマーケットプレイスと連携可能です。これらの外部サービスとの通信中に、ユーザーが意図しない取引が自動的に発行される場合があります。特に、スマートコントラクトの不具合や、ユーザーが誤って許可(Approve)を実行した場合、特定のトークンの使用権限が悪用される可能性があります。これにより、意図しない金額が何度も送信される「無限アクセス」的な状況が発生し、二重請求の要因となります。
2.4 悪意あるフィッシング攻撃や詐欺サイト
悪意ある第三者が、似たような名前の偽のWebサイトやアプリを作成し、ユーザーを騙す事例も報告されています。たとえば、「Trust Walletの更新が必要です」という偽の通知を送り、ユーザーが個人鍵やシードフレーズを入力させることで、本人のウォレットを乗っ取るという攻撃です。この場合、攻撃者はユーザーの資金を勝手に送金でき、複数回の送金が行われる可能性があります。このような場合、二重請求は「ユーザーの責任」と見なされることが多く、返金が困難になる場合もあります。
3. 二重請求が発生したときの即時対処法
3.1 状況の確認:トランザクションの履歴をチェック
まず、Trust Walletアプリ内で「トランザクション履歴」を確認し、実際に二重の送金が行われたかを検証してください。すべてのトランザクションは、ブロックチェーン上に公開されているため、EtherscanやBscScanなどのブロックチェーンエクスプローラーを使って、送金先アドレス、金額、タイムスタンプなどを詳細に確認できます。もし2つの異なるトランザクションが同様の金額を送信している場合は、二重請求が成立していると考えられます。
3.2 送金先の確認と連絡
送金先が正当な相手であるか、またその相手が二重請求に気づいているかどうかを確認することが重要です。たとえば、購入した商品の販売者であれば、返金を依頼できる可能性があります。ただし、仮想通貨の取引は基本的に不可逆的であるため、相手が返金を拒否する場合も少なくありません。その際は、可能な限り証拠(トランザクションハッシュ、日時、金額など)を保存し、後続の対応に備えてください。
3.3 Trust Walletサポートへの問い合わせ
Trust Walletの公式サポートチームに、状況を正確に記述して連絡してください。公式メールアドレスや公式フォーラムを通じて、以下の情報を添付して送信しましょう:
- 発生した二重請求のトランザクションハッシュ(2つ分)
- 送金日時と金額
- 使用していたデバイスとOSバージョン
- 再送信の理由(例:ネットワーク遅延、画面表示異常など)
- 関連するスクリーンショットやログファイル
ただし、公式サポートはあくまで情報提供や調査を行う立場であり、必ずしも返金を保証するものではありません。特に、ユーザーの誤操作や悪意ある行為によって引き起こされた場合、返金対応は難しい場合があります。
3.4 他の関連機関への報告
もし二重請求が、詐欺サイトやフィッシング攻撃によるものだと判断された場合、以下のような機関に報告することをおすすめします:
- 日本国内:消費者庁(https://www.caa.go.jp)
- 国際的なサイバー犯罪対策機関:INTERPOL Cybercrime Unit
- 仮想通貨関連の監視団体:Chainalysis、TRM Labs
これらの機関は、悪意あるアドレスや取引パターンを追跡し、将来的な被害防止に貢献します。また、報告内容が信用できる場合、一部の企業や取引所が協力して返金を検討する可能性もあります。
4. 二重請求を防ぐための予防策
4.1 ガス代の適切な設定
トランザクションの処理速度を確保するために、適切なガス代(Gas Fee)を設定することが不可欠です。Trust Walletでは、通常「標準」「高速」「最速」の3段階から選択できます。ネットワークが混雑している時期には、「高速」または「最速」を選んでおくことで、トランザクションが迅速に承認され、再送信の必要が減ります。また、定期的にガス代の推移を確認し、最適な設定を調整しましょう。
4.2 バージョンアップの徹底
Trust Walletの最新バージョンは、既知のバグの修正やセキュリティ強化が施されています。常にApp StoreやGoogle Playの最新版をインストールし、自動更新を有効にしておくことが重要です。古いバージョンでは、不具合が発生しやすく、二重請求のリスクが高まります。
4.3 許可(Approve)の慎重な操作
DeFiやNFT取引においては、「Allow」や「Approve」ボタンを押す必要があります。しかし、この操作はトークンの使用権限を与えるものであり、一度許可すると、そのトークンが任意のスマートコントラクトに送られる可能性があります。そのため、許可する前に、どのアプリにどのような権限を与えているかをよく確認し、不要な許可は一切行わないようにしましょう。
4.4 二段階認証(2FA)の導入
Trust Walletは、パスワードやシードフレーズの保護のために、二段階認証(2FA)の設定が可能です。特に、Google AuthenticatorやAuthyなどの認証アプリと連携することで、不正アクセスのリスクを大幅に軽減できます。また、ハードウェアウォレット(例:Ledger、Trezor)との連携も推奨され、最も高いレベルのセキュリティを実現できます。
4.5 個人鍵・シードフレーズの厳重管理
Trust Walletの安全性は、ユーザー自身が保持する「シードフレーズ」に大きく依存します。この12語または24語のリストは、ウォレットの復元に必須であり、誰にも見せないよう完全に秘匿する必要があります。物理的なメモ帳に書く場合でも、その場所は他人に見えない安全な場所に保管し、デジタル形式での保存は絶対に避けてください。万一、シードフレーズが漏洩した場合、資金はすぐに盗まれる危険があります。
5. 結論:リスクを理解し、冷静に対処する
Trust Walletは、ユーザーが自分の資産を直接管理できる強力なツールですが、その一方で、二重請求のようなトラブルに巻き込まれるリスクも伴います。本稿で述べたように、二重請求の原因は技術的な問題、ユーザーの誤操作、あるいは悪意ある攻撃など多岐にわたります。しかし、重要なのは、トラブルが発生したときに慌てず、冷静に状況を把握し、適切な対処を行うことです。
まずは、トランザクションの履歴を確認し、ブロックチェーンエクスプローラーで実態を検証しましょう。次に、信頼できるサポート窓口へ情報を提出し、必要に応じて関連機関に報告を行います。また、将来のリスク回避のためにも、ガス代の適切な設定、アプリの最新化、許可操作の慎重さ、そして個人情報の厳重管理を徹底することが求められます。
仮想通貨は、新しい金融インフラとして大きな可能性を持ちながらも、ユーザーの責任が非常に大きい領域です。二重請求のようなトラブルは、個々のユーザーの知識と注意深さによって左右されます。正しい知識を持ち、常に警戒心を保つことで、安心かつ安全なデジタル資産運用が可能になります。
最終的に、トラストウォレットを使用する上で最も大切なことは、「自己責任」の意識を持つこと、そして「自分だけの守り方」を確立することです。それが、未来の資産を守る最良の手段なのです。